** The Acura repair market for residents of Ashfield, MA, is characterized by a need to travel to nearby commercial hubs for specialized service. There are no dedicated Acura specialists within the town itself. The market in the surrounding region (Franklin and Hampshire counties) is moderately competitive, with a clear distinction between general repair shops and the few specialists like those listed above. **Average Quality:** The average quality for general auto repair is good, but the expertise for Acura-specific systems (SH-AWD, advanced i-VTM4 torque vectoring, hybrid systems, AcuraLink) is concentrated in a handful of shops. The providers identified represent the upper echelon in terms of technical capability. **Competition Level:** Competition is not saturated for true specialists. The most significant competition for these independent shops comes from the authorized Acura dealership, which is located further away in Hartford, CT, or outside Springfield, MA. The independents compete effectively by offering personalized service, lower labor rates, and often more extensive experience with older Acura models.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ing for specialized Acura repair in this region is above average for general repair but typically 20-30% lower than dealership rates. Expect to pay $115 - $150 per hour for labor at a specialist. Complex diagnostics or advanced safety system calibrations requiring specific tools will command premium pricing.

Given our rural roads and winter climate, common issues include suspension wear from potholes, brake system maintenance due to hilly terrain, and ensuring all-wheel-drive systems (like SH-AWD) are functioning properly for snowy conditions. Electrical issues related to infotainment systems in older models are also frequently addressed by local specialists.
Look for a shop with ASE-certified technicians who have specific experience with Honda/Acura vehicles, as the platforms are closely related. In our rural area, personal recommendations from other Acura owners in Franklin County are invaluable, and you should verify the shop uses quality OEM or OEM-equivalent parts for repairs.
While independent shops in Ashfield often have lower labor rates than dealerships, the specialized nature of Acura repairs can still command a premium. However, you save on the travel and towing distance for service, which is a significant local consideration given our distance from urban dealer centers.
Seek immediate local diagnosis for critical warnings like the check engine light, brake system light, or oil pressure light, especially before navigating the steep, winding routes out of Ashfield. A local shop can perform initial diagnostics and advise if the issue is safe to drive or requires specialized dealer-only tools.
The harsh winter conditions and road salt demand more frequent undercarriage inspections and thorough brake checks. Additionally, the stop-and-go driving on our narrow, rural roads can lead to more frequent transmission service intervals compared to highway-heavy driving in other regions.
